Entrepreneur who secured £140k from Dragons’ Den invests in high-growth Bristol SEO firms

Expanding Bristol search engine optimisation (SEO) firms upUgo and GoRank are poised for further expansion after securing investment from Dragons’ Den entrepreneur Imran Hakim. Tech star Brightpearl looking to shine in global retail market after Sage leads £25m funding round

Business management systems giant Sage has taken a minority investment in fast-growing Bristol-based retail management software firm Brightpearl as part of a £25m fundraising round aimed at triggering further international expansion. Takeover sparks further expansion in UK and Asia for recruiter Sanderson

Sanderson, the long-established Bristol-headquartered recruitment group, has strengthened its operations in the UK and South East Asia further following its latest acquisition. Air ambulance operator lands in Bristol in latest deal by Lansdown family’s investment group

Billionaire businessman Stephen Lansdown’s Guernsey-based investment group has entered the air ambulance market with an acquisition made through its Bristol Airport-based aviation services firm Centreline. Former eCommerce agency boss joins Manchester firm to launch its new Bristol office

Full-service eCommerce firm PushON has opened an office in Bristol after recruiting the co-founder of one of the city’s most-successful Magento agencies. Export Academy set up to give Bristol firms help selling to overseas markets

Bristol’s small businesses can access help and advice to grow internationally through a new, free, post-Brexit programme. Thrive Renewables plugs into its first battery storage scheme, with support from TLT

Bristol-based specialist energy investment company Thrive Renewables has invested in its first battery storage project in a deal handled by city-headquartered national law firm TLT. New ‘body blow’ for Bristol businesses as UK enters third national lockdown

The latest lockdown will be another “body blow” to Bristol firms, coming after the uncertainty caused by Brexit and lost trade in the run-up to Christmas, the region’s biggest business group has warned. Smith & Williamson’s corporate finance team end 2020 on a high with two major deals

The Bristol office of national accountancy group Smith & Williamson capped off a successful 2020 by completing two deals – a management buyout at a robotics firm and a sale of an e-learning business.
